Product Overview
A tower brace ties the two front strut mounting areas together to reduce body flex between them. It is a useful chassis upgrade for drivers who want a more connected front-end feel or need to replace a missing or damaged brace.
Engine cover, intake, Shaker scoop, supercharger, and underhood options determine clearance. This style is not supported for Shaker-equipped or SRT Hellcat applications unless an exact physical comparison proves otherwise.

Q: Will this fit a Challenger with a Shaker hood? A: No. Shaker-equipped applications are excluded because of underhood clearance.
Q: Does it fit Hellcat models? A: This brace style is not supported for SRT Hellcat engine layouts.
Q: Will a strut brace fix worn suspension parts? A: No. It may reduce chassis flex, but worn mounts, bushings, struts, or alignment problems need separate repair.
